ARM Holdings
1 The company was founded as Advanced RISC Machines, ARM, a joint venture between Acorn Computers, Apple Computer (now Apple Inc.) and VLSI Technology. The new
company intended to further the development of the Acorn RISC Machine's RISC chip, which was originally used in the Acorn Archimedes
and had been selected by Apple for their Newton project. The design was flexible and is
now the processing core for many custom application-specific integrated circuits.

Xbox 360 technical problems - Causes
1 Electronics industry newspaper EE Times reported that the problems may have started in the graphics chip. Microsoft
designed the chip in-house to cut out the traditional Application-specific integrated circuit|ASIC vendor with the goal of saving money in ASIC design costs. After multiple product failures, Microsoft went back to an ASIC vendor and had the chip redesigned
so it would dissipate less heat.

ASIC
1 An 'application-specific integrated circuit (ASIC)' , is an integrated
circuit (IC) customized for a particular use, rather than intended
for general-purpose use. For example, a chip designed to run in a
digital voice recorder is an ASIC. Application-specific standard
products (ASSPs) are intermediate between ASICs and industry standard
integrated circuits like the 7400 series|7400 or the 4000 series.

CMOS - Power: switching and leakage
1 CMOS logic dissipates less power than NMOS logic circuits because CMOS dissipates power only when switching (dynamic power). On a typical application-specific integrated circuit|
ASIC in a modern 90 nanometer process, switching the output might take 120
picoseconds, and happens once every ten nanoseconds. NMOS logic dissipates power
whenever the transistor is on, because there is a current path from Vdd to Vss through the
load resistor and the n-type network.

Intel Corporation - SRAMS and the microprocessor
1 Originally developed for the Japanese company Busicom to replace a number of Application-specific
integrated circuit|ASICs in a calculator already produced by
Busicom, the Intel 4004 was introduced to the mass market on November 15, 1971, though the
microprocessor did not become the core of Intel's business until the mid-
1980shttps://store.theartofservice.com/the-application-specific-integrated-circuit-toolkit.html

Content switch - Layer 3 switching
1 The major difference between the packet switching operation of a
router (computing)|router and that of a Network layer|Layer 3 switch is the physical implementation. In general-
purpose routers, packet switching takes place using software that runs
on a microprocessor, whereas a Layer 3 switch performs this using
dedicated application-specific integrated circuit (ASIC) hardware.

LSI Logic - 1981-2004
1 LSI Logic started developing its CoreWare technology in 1992. In 1993, Sony Computer
Entertainment chose LSI Logic as their application-specific integrated circuit|ASIC
partner, charged with fitting the PlayStation CPU on a single chip. LSI’s CoreWare could
do it, while other offers made to Sony needed two chips. Sony also worked with
LSI’s engineers develop the graphics engine, DMA controller, Channel I/O|I/O and bus
controllers.

Application-specific standard product
1 An 'application specific standard product' or 'ASSP' is an integrated circuit that
implements a specific function that appeals to a wide market. As opposed to
Application-specific integrated circuit|ASICs that combine a collection of functions and
are designed by or for one customer, ASSPs are available as off-the-shelf components.
ASSPs are used in all industries, from automotive to communications.

Uncommitted Logic Array
1 A 'gate array' or 'uncommitted logic array' ('ULA') is an approach to the
design and manufacture of application-specific integrated
circuits (ASICs), using a prefabricated chip with active devices like NAND-gates, that are later interconnected
according to a custom order by adding metal layers in the factory
environment.https://store.theartofservice.com/the-application-specific-integrated-circuit-toolkit.html

Full custom
1 Full-custom design potentially maximizes the performance of the chip, and minimizes its area, but is
extremely labor-intensive to implement. Full-custom design is
limited to ICs that are to be fabricated in extremely high
volumes, notably certain microprocessors and a small number
of Application-specific integrated circuit|ASICs.

Display controller - Alternatives to a VDC chip
1 An often used hybrid solution was to use a video interface controller (often the
Motorola 6845) as a basis and expand its capabilities with programmable logic or an Application-specific integrated circuit|ASIC. An example of such a hybrid solution is the
original VGA card, that used an 6845 in combination with an ASIC, that is the reason
why all current VGA based video systems still use the hardware registers that were
provided by the 6845.https://store.theartofservice.com/the-application-specific-integrated-circuit-toolkit.html

Science of photography - Focus
1 The autofocus system in modern Single-lens reflex camera|SLRs use a detector|
sensor in the mirrorbox to measure contrast. The sensor's signal is analyzed by
an application-specific integrated circuit (ASIC), and the ASIC tries to maximize the contrast pattern by moving lens elements. The ASICs in modern cameras also have special algorithms for predicting motion,
and other advanced features.

Pirate decryption - Technical issues
1 The DirecTV F card was replaced with the H card, which contained an application-specific
integrated circuit to handle decryption. However, due to similarities between the H and other existing cards, it became apparent that while the signal could not be received without the card and its application-specific integrated circuit|ASIC, the card itself was vulnerable to
tampering by reprogramming it to add channel tiers or additional programming, opening TV channels to the prying eyes of the pirates.

PSoC - Overview
1 PSoC resembles an Application-specific integrated circuit|ASIC:
blocks can be assigned a wide range of functions and interconnected on-
chip. Unlike an ASIC, there is no special manufacturing process required to create the custom
configuration - only startup code that is created by Cypress' PSoC Designer
(for PSoC 1) or PSoC Creator (for PSoC 3 / 4 / 5) Integrated
development environment|IDE.

Softmodem - Evolution and technology
1 As more sophisticated transmission schemes were devised, the circuits grew in complexity, mixing analog with digital parts and eventually incorporating multiple
integrated circuit|ICs such as logical gates, PLLs and microcontrollers, while the techniques used in modern
V.34 (recommendation)|V.34, V.90 (recommendation)|V.90 and V.92 protocols (like 1024-Quadrature amplitude
modulation|QAM) are so complex that implementing a modem supporting them with discrete components or general purpose IC's would be very impractical, and a dedicated Digital signal processor|DSP or Application-
specific integrated circuit|ASIC is used instead, effectively turning the modem into a special embedded system, a
dedicated computer in its own right.
